Web data analyst duties include building reporting dashboards with data from the two careers websites and providing analyses of that data to help leadership make informed decisions on recruitment campaign optimization... and improve website functionality to enhance the user experience. The position collaborates with various HR departments and external vendors to develop comprehensive reporting, and works closely with HR Communications & Marketing teammates to develop insightful and actionable analyses.

Webmaster duties include managing the organization's main HR website including routine maintenance, creating and editing webpages, addressing accessibility, and building new web components to meet evolving team needs.

This position offers the ability to work across many technology platforms, and allows for creativity and growth with the diversity of opportunities to provide ideas and recommendations to improve the effectiveness of UVA HR’s various websites, and to elevate the experiences of our many users.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

Analytics & Reporting:
• Generate Looker Studio web analytics quarterly reports for two UVA Careers Websites tracking user engagement and overall site usage to help inform web needs and recruitment marketing decisions.
• Analyze report data to identify trends and patterns such webpage engagement levels, keywords driving the most traffic, and which marketing campaigns drive the most applications.
• Partner with digital marketing, recruiting, and technology stakeholder teams to understand site results and explain user behavior.
• Update dashboards monthly with paid digital marketing results from vendors.
• Educate internal teams on self-serve website report options available on-demand.
• Make web optimizations and site roadmap recommendations based on web traffic data.
• Participate in the design and development of future career website initiatives that address evolving enhancements for candidate capture

Webmaster:
• Maintain UVA HR website ensuring it consistently meets organizational needs and requirements.
• Manage overall website health including accessibility, usability, page speed, and performance. Address issues found in SiteImprove weekly.
• Design and develop new website components to address evolving team needs and enhance the user experience.
• Assist content managers with the development of webpages. Update and edit web content and design as needed ensuring they are accessible and user-friendly.
• Manage internal HR web editor training, provide support, and update training modules as needed.

Other:
• Provide back-up webmaster services for UVA Careers Websites CMS supporting Recruitment Marketing team members.
• Use Marketing Cloud platform to set-up and send emails, and create data extensions, supporting Communications team members.
